Lopinavir
Lopinavir is a protease inhibitor used with ritonavir in combination HIV treatment. Listed uses include HIV Infection.
Key points
- Lopinavir is used as a boosted combination, not alone.
- It has extensive interactions and can affect liver, pancreas, glucose, lipids and heart rhythm.
- Severe abdominal pain, jaundice or fainting needs urgent care.

Important safety checks
The full HIV regimen, resistance, liver disease, pancreatitis, heart rhythm and all medicines require specialist review.
When to seek urgent care
Seek urgent help for severe abdominal pain with vomiting, jaundice, fainting, an irregular heartbeat or a severe rash.
